I was thinking, after one of my characters was put in jail, about how to Rp it, and I decided that it is -really- hard to Rp in jails when the jailer will probably only go in for a few minutes, and then leave again, before you can wake up. You cannot give him anything to go on about you, other than perhaps in notes.
That was what made this pop into my head, and I thought it would be great for all sorts of things, purely as an RP tool.
In your character page, where you can see the stats and bars of your character, there should be a bar where you can input the -position- of your character. Say if you were farming cotton you could type in "He is standing in the middle of a cotton field". Or if they were in jail it could be "She is huddling in the corner of the jail, silently crying". This would allow people who were not there for possible Rp, because they are in a different location, to see what that character is currently doing/feeling. For example you could put in that your character is "Standing in the middle of the town and smiling". This would of course appear to other people looking at your char description page, after the project that they are doing.
What do you think? I think it would be a good RP tool.

It would be somewhat abusable. E.g. "goitre is patting his pet dragon," etc. But, on the other hand, it may be a handy feature if used properly. E.g. "goitre is busily flicking through a large pile of notes."
The ability to speak, and use *emotes*, exists without (immediate) controls, and it's equally possible to write *he pats his pet dragon*, and so is equally abusable.
I have a feeling that many would forget to change their status, leaving "goitre is cooking a hearty stew," while the character has begun crushing hematite, for example.
